Figure 6.
A scatter plot displaying actual versus calculated energy consumption, with data points in blue and a dotted regression line. The R-squared value is indicated as zero point nine seven eight seven.The image features a scatter plot illustrating the relationship between actual energy consumption and calculated energy consumption, both measured in megajoules per kilogram. The horizontal axis represents calculated energy consumption, ranging from 0 to 2 megajoules per kilogram, while the vertical axis shows actual energy consumption over the same range. Data points are depicted in blue, forming a trend that suggests a strong positive correlation, with a dotted line indicating the regression line. The R squared value is presented as R squared equals 0 point 9 7 8 7, suggesting high correlation between the two variables.

Comparison of actual energy consumption with calculated model predictions
